Corrupt or incorrect registry entries in the system files.Existence of viruses, malware, adware, or spyware in the system.Improper hardware or application installations or uninstallations.Corrupt, damaged, or Misconfigured system files.Missing or damage service-related DLL file.Corruption of the service-related DLL file.These conditions are listed below as follows. There are a variety of conditions that may trigger Error 126. It is important to take corrective measures immediately to ensure that no such problems are encountered again in the future. When Error 126 is generated, it terminates the installation process almost instantly. They usually occur during the installation of some Windows program or application. Error 126 is a very commonly occurring error that is often the result of damaged system files of Windows.
